Airfares Surge Amid Rising Fuel Costs from Regional Conflict
Airfares have increased sharply due to escalating fuel prices tied to the ongoing war involving Iran. Carriers report significant hikes on transatlantic and transpacific routes as airlines adjust for higher jet fuel expenses.
